About

Joseph Fan is a scholar working on Ophthalmology, Molecular Biology and Neurology. According to data from OpenAlex, Joseph Fan has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 315 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Ophthalmology, 5 papers in Molecular Biology and 3 papers in Neurology. Recurrent topics in Joseph Fan’s work include Retinal Development and Disorders (4 papers), Retinal and Optic Conditions (3 papers) and Ocular Diseases and Behçet’s Syndrome (3 papers). Joseph Fan is often cited by papers focused on Retinal Development and Disorders (4 papers), Retinal and Optic Conditions (3 papers) and Ocular Diseases and Behçet’s Syndrome (3 papers). Joseph Fan collaborates with scholars based in United States, Mexico and United Kingdom. Joseph Fan's co-authors include F.W. Fitzke, Anthony S. Halfyard, Alan C. Bird, Andrea von Rückmann, Dennis M. Robertson, Ronald E. Smith, Melvin D. Trousdale, George B. Bartley, Helmut Buettner and James P. Bolling and has published in prestigious journals such as Ophthalmology, American Journal of Ophthalmology and The Journal of Pathology.
